OverviewThe Unlikely Disruptor: South Carolina's First Black Woman to Run for Governor is a powerful, unflinching memoir by Mia S. McLeod, a principled, trailblazing leader who has spent her life disrupting systems that were designed to exclude her. Mia was the first person to serve in multiple historic roles across South Carolina's executive and legislative branches including: the first Black woman to run for governor of South Carolina and one of only two Black women from her state to receive the prestigious John F. Kennedy Profile in Courage Award. The Unlikely Disruptor is a portrait of fearless leadership rooted in faith, moral clarity, and transformation. ABOUT THE AUTHOR Mia S. McLeod is a barrier-breaker, truth-teller, political trailblazer and 2023 John F. Kennedy Profile in Courage Award recipient. She was the first woman to represent South Carolina House District 79 and South Carolina Senate District 22 and the first Black woman in her state's history to run for governor. Her first book, The Unlikely Disruptor: South Carolina's First Black Woman to Run for Governor, is a deeply personal account of what it means to lead with courage and conviction-revealing how faith, authenticity, and fearlessness fueled her fight to transform South Carolina politics and power.
